Oldtimer has a major problem with the term "Director of Speedway". In fact, he's brought this up so many times he's obviously scarily obsessed with it. It's been explained to him on here why he was labelled with that title, but for some bizarre reason he just won't let it lie. The title "Director of Speedway" was used in press releases because at the time Chris Louis took over the day to day running of the club, he didn't have his promoters licence and wasn't allowed to use the term "promoter/co-promoter". He's now had his promoters licence for some years, but the "Director Of Speedway" tag has stuck with some media sources, although on the BSPA website in which I assume Oldtimer has taken his quote, they quite clearly state "Co-promoter" and not "Director Of Speedway" as this sad fool states in his post.

Totally agree. King has looked off colour this year, but there seems to be mitigating circumstances behind that. If you look at the final Elite league greensheets at the end of last season, King averaged 7.46. To put it in to perspective, Cook finished on 7.40, Doyle 7.30, Barker 6.47 and Kennett 6.39. King also finished with a higher Elite league average last season than Davey Watt, Rory Schlein, Mads Korneliussen, Chris Harris, Seb Ulamek, Janowski, Swiderski, Bridger. King has found his level nobody is suggesting otherwise, but that level is a good solid top flight rider, and almost certainly a powerful PL number 1. It beggars belief that the likes of Had Enough are luke warm on the idea of King, then suggesting a top 2 of Worrall and Ricky bloody Wells whilst others would prefer Rohan Tungate! Bizarre.
